Reverse description Isis Pharia represented standing to the right upon the prow of a ship, her robes billowing as she holds an inflated sail outstretched before her with both hands. The composition references the goddess's association with seafaring and her protective role over navigation, a type frequently struck at Cyme. A Greek civic legend encircles the type within a dotted border, recording the name of the presiding magistrate and the civic ethnonym.
Reverse script Log in to see details
Reverse lettering Ε ϹΥΝΦΕΡΟΝΤΟϹ Β ΚΥΜΑΙΩΝ
(Translation: under Sympheron II, of the Cymeans)
